Output 59ea6ec9960e99d1f09d9cc30a942bc199949b9ed4799524a15c1720ea1d9497:1

value
1065719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e2a54718cf10f200e501f2286e625e0d43a72f OP_EQUAL
address
3DzDyryjv9oJaoS71S6JVyQi6ccRd8f2hr
transaction
59ea6ec9960e99d1f09d9cc30a942bc199949b9ed4799524a15c1720ea1d9497
confirmations
250168
spent
true